The No. 19 Pilots Win the 2010 Nike Invitational with a 2-1 Victory over No. 30 Evansville


PORTLAND, Ore. --- Portland senior Ryan Luke scored twice and senior goalkeeper Austin Guerrero came up with two clutch saves in the closing minutes as the No. 19 Pilots defeated the No. 30 Evansville Purple Aces 2-1 on the final day of Nike Invitational on Sunday at Merlo Field. The win allows Portland (1-0-1) to claim the tournament title.
No. 19 Pilots Play Northern Illinois to a 0-0 Draw


PORTLAND, Ore. --- The No. 19 Portland Pilots opened the 2010 season with a 0-0 tie with the Northern Illinois Huskies on the first day of the Nike Invitational on Friday night at Merlo Field. The Pilots (0-0-1) had their chances, out-shooting the Huskies 17-10, but NIU (0-0-1) was able to hold on for the draw.

Pilots Score on their First Two Shots and Cruise to a 3-1 Exhibition Win over Oregon State


PORTLAND, Ore. --- The No. 19 Portland Pilots scored two goals just 34 seconds apart in the first half and added another goal in the second half en route to a 3-1 win over the Oregon State Beavers in an exhibition soccer match at Merlo Field on Wednesday night. Junior transfer Conner Barbaree and freshman Steven Evans both scored their first goal with the Pilots.

Pilots Picked to Finish Second in WCC, Land Three on Preseason All-Conference Team


SAN BRUNO, Calif. --- In a wide-open West Coast Conference, the Portland Pilots were picked to finish second, narrowly missing the top spot in the 2010 WCC Men’s Soccer Preseason Coaches Poll. Seniors Austin Guerrero and Jarad vanSchaik and junior Ryan Kawulok were voted to the WCC’s Preseason All-Conference Team, giving the Pilots a league-high three selections.

No. 19 Pilots Kick-Off the 2010 Season with First Training Session


PORTLAND, Ore. --- The 19th-ranked Portland Pilots men’s soccer team began its quest to return to the post-season with the first official practice of the 2010 season at the Clive Charles Soccer Complex on Wednesday morning. The Pilots are fresh off a visit to the third round of the 2009 NCAA Playoffs, which was farther than any other West Coast Conference team.
